Brewton Babe Ruth 15s currently 1-1 in district tourney

Published 11:09 am Monday, July 9, 2012

The Brewton Babe Ruth 15-year-old all-star team kicked off their district tournament Friday night in Atmore and suffered a 3-2 loss to the host team Atmore all-stars.
After falling in game one Friday, Brewton rebounded in their second game Sunday night as they cruised their way to a 17-1 win over Evergreen.
Brewton, 1-1 in tournament play, was set to play Atmore Monday night at 6 p.m. in the championship game. Brewton would need to win twice to claim the title. If Brewton won the first game Monday, a second game was scheduled to be played at 8 p.m.

Atmore 3, Brewton 2
In a pitcher’s duel Friday night between Brewton and Atmore, the Brewton 15s were edged out by one, 3-2.
Brewton was held to only three hits in the loss while Atmore had five.
Atmore led Brewton 2-0 after the first inning and 3-0 after three innings after Atmore plated one run in the bottom of the third.
Brewton would cut the lead to one in the top of the fourth as they scored two runs, but that would be as close as they would get.
Tyler Joyner had a single in the loss for Brewton while Michael Williams added two singles.
On the mound for Brewton, Joyner took the loss as he went six innings and allowed five hits, three runs, walked two and struck out eight.
Brewton struck out 11 times in the loss.
Tanner Smith earned the win on the mound for Atmore as he went seven innings and allowed three hits, two runs, walked six and hit one.
At the plate for Atmore, Barron McDonald, Trey Weeks, Nate Smith, Tyler Peebles, and Chasin Freeman all had singles.

Brewton 17, Evergreen 1
In their second game of the tournament Sunday in Atmore, Brewton used a 12-run third inning to cruise their way to a 16-run win over Evergreen, 17-1.
Brewton and Evergreen were tied 1-1 after the first inning before Brewton scored 16 runs over the second, third and fourth innings to get the win.
Brewton scored two runs in the second, 12 in the third and two more in the fourth to propel them to the win.
Williams, Hunter Harp and Todd Mayo pitched in the win for Brewton. Williams went the first inning to get the win while Harp went the next two innings and Mayo went the final two innings. Combined, the trio allowed one run on one hit, walked six and struck out five.
At the plate for Brewton, Robin Swift led in the win as he had two singles and a homerun and five RBIs.
Miles Powell had a triple while Joyner added a single.
Harp had a single in the win while Mayo had a single and a double and one RBI.
Chris Jones had a single and a double and two RBIs while Keaton Parker had a single.
Rob Jones added three singles and two RBIs while Dylan Etheridge had a single and two RBIs.
